package java.security;
import java.security.spec.AlgorithmParameterSpec;

/**
	AlgorithmParameterGeneratorSpi is the Service Provider 
	Interface for the AlgorithmParameterGenerator class. 
	This class is used to generate the algorithm parameters
	for a specific algorithm.

	@since JDK 1.2

	@author Mark Benvenuto
*/
public abstract class AlgorithmParameterGeneratorSpi
{

/**
	Constructs a new AlgorithmParameterGeneratorSpi
*/
public AlgorithmParameterGeneratorSpi()
{}

/**
	Initializes the parameter generator with the specified size
	and SecureRandom

	@param size the size( in number of bits) 
	@param random the SecureRandom class to use for randomness
*/
protected abstract void engineInit(int size, SecureRandom random);

/**
	Initializes the parameter generator with the specified
	AlgorithmParameterSpec and SecureRandom classes.

	If genParamSpec is an invalid AlgorithmParameterSpec for this
	AlgorithmParameterGeneratorSpi then it throws
	InvalidAlgorithmParameterException

	@param genParamSpec the AlgorithmParameterSpec class to use
	@param random the SecureRandom class to use for randomness

	@throws InvalidAlgorithmParameterException genParamSpec is invalid
*/
protected abstract void engineInit(AlgorithmParameterSpec genParamSpec, SecureRandom random) throws InvalidAlgorithmParameterException;


/**
	Generate a new set of AlgorithmParameters.

	@returns a new set of algorithm parameters
*/
protected abstract AlgorithmParameters engineGenerateParameters();

}
